Subject: DR drill — admin bulk edits

Hi all, Thursday's disaster-recovery drill will simulate a corrupted bulk edit in the Ledgerline admin table. New team members: please review the bulk-edit rollback procedure beforehand, as you may be asked to execute it under observation. To open the drill environment, enter the recovery passphrase provided below.

strongbox words: belath-holwyn-quenir-pelmir-istix-quenius-quenix-pramir-pelax-belax

# Ledgerpane Environments

Ledgerpane (audit-log viewer) runs in three environments: dev, staging, prod. Dev resets nightly. Staging mirrors prod data with a 24h delay and scrubbed actor names. Prod is read-only for support; escalate writes to the platform team. Retention and query limits differ per environment. Support should verify against staging first. Staging currently runs with these settings.

config for kafof-bawef:
holath:
  log_level: debug
  metrics_host: metrics.holath.qorvelsys.internal
  pin: 2191
  pool_size: 32

- [ ] Step 7: Archive cold storage buckets (Glacierline tier). Confirm both ceremony witnesses are present, verify bucket manifests match the Oxbow ledger, then seal the archive key shares. Plugin authors may observe but not handle shares. Once sealed, the archive index itself is encrypted and can only be reopened with the passphrase below.

vault phrase of badup-hahig = tamael-aldael-kelmir-istael-fenok-istwyn-tamius-jorath-oliion

## Runbook: Deploy status bot

The Larchpost bot answers deploy-status queries in team channels and exposes a plugin hook so you can register custom commands. Plugins run in a sandboxed worker; they receive the parsed command and must respond within five seconds or the bot posts a timeout notice. Rate limits apply per channel, not per plugin. When wiring up a local test instance, start the bot with the following configuration values.

service settings:
PRAIX_LOG_LEVEL=error
PRAIX_METRICS_HOST=metrics.praix.qorvelcorp.corp
PRAIX_POOL_SIZE=16